WebPosted in Low back, Thoracic. Vertebral compression fractures (VCF’s) are the most common osteoporotic fragility fractures. They have an incidence in the United Kingdom of 120,000 per annum (1). VCF’s are considered a red flag pathology of the spine due to the devastating consequences (albeit rare) they can have upon the patient’s health (2). WebA fracture, or break, in one of the cervical vertebrae is commonly called a broken neck. Cervical fractures usually result from high-energy trauma, such as automobile crashes or falls. In elderly people, ground-level falls, …
